Defined the end behavior of the following function f(x)=-x^5+x^2-x

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

Note that the highest power of x is 5, which is odd.  Also note that the sign of the coefficient of x^5 is negative.  Hence, the graph begins in Quadrant II, generally decreasing as x increases, and ends in Quadrant IV.
